Understanding PCIe Slot Compatibility: Can You Put a PCIe x1 in a x16 Slot?

When building or upgrading a computer, understanding PCIe slot compatibility is crucial. A common question is whether a PCIe x1 card can be used in an x16 slot. The answer is yes, you can insert a PCIe x1 card into a PCIe x16 slot. However, there are several factors to consider to ensure optimal performance and compatibility.
How PCIe Slots Work
PCIe slots come in various sizes, such as x1, x4, x8, and x16, which indicate the number of lanes available for data transfer. While a PCIe x1 card has fewer lanes, the design of PCIe slots allows them to be backward compatible. This means a smaller card like the x1 can fit into a larger slot like x16, though it will only use the lanes it supports (x1 in this case).
Considerations for Using a PCIe x1 in a x16 Slot
Before installing a PCIe x1 card in an x16 slot, ensure the motherboard’s firmware is up to date to support such configurations. Additionally, check that other components do not physically block the slot, as x16 slots are often used for larger graphics cards.
Troubleshooting USB Slot Issues
Encountering a USB slot not working can be frustrating, especially when peripherals are essential to your setup. Here are some steps to troubleshoot and resolve the issue:
- Check physical connections and ensure the USB device is properly seated.
- Try connecting the device to another USB port to rule out port issues.
- Update or reinstall USB drivers through the device manager.
- Inspect the USB port for any physical damage.
- Restart your computer to reset hardware connections.
